Top 6 Important Documents Required To Start Export Business
Required Documents to Start Export Business in India
Starting an export business can open doors to international markets and higher profit opportunities. With increasing global demand for Indian goods such as textiles, agricultural products, and handicrafts, many entrepreneurs are stepping into the export industry. However, before beginning, it is important to understand the required documents to start export business to ensure smooth and legal operations.
Importance of Documentation for Exporters
Export business involves legal compliance, customs procedures, and international transactions. Proper documentation helps in avoiding delays, ensures smooth clearance of goods, and builds strong relationships with overseas buyers. Without the correct documents, exporting goods is not possible.
Essential Documents for Export Business
1. Business Registration
To operate legally, you must register your business as a proprietorship, partnership, LLP, or private limited company.
2. Import Export Code (IEC)
IEC is a mandatory registration issued by DGFT. It is required for all export-import ...
... activities, including customs clearance and receiving foreign payments.
3. GST Registration
GST registration is necessary for tax compliance, billing, and claiming export benefits, even though exports are zero-rated.
4. Current Bank Account and AD Code
A current account is essential for handling international payments. Exporters must also obtain an AD Code from their bank for customs documentation.
5. Export Promotion Council Registration
This registration helps exporters gain access to industry support, export incentives, and global buyer networks.
6. Digital Signature Certificate (DSC)
DSC is used for secure online filing of applications and submission of export-related documents.
Other Documents Used in Export Process
During shipping, exporters require documents like commercial invoice, packing list, bill of lading, and certificate of origin. These documents are important for smooth logistics and customs clearance.
